I connected by desktop report to existing semantic model created my collegue.
when i'm working in desktop all data and KPI is showing data but after publishing it power bi service visuals and KPI throwing an error. help me with resolving this error.
Solved! Go to Solution.
Go to Workspace → Semantic model → Settings
Open Data source credentials
Find the Web data source
Re-enter credentials (OAuth / Anonymous / API key, as required)
Save
